- Bontebok herds — The park was created to save this striking, low-slung antelope, and you’ll often see groups grazing in the open grasslands at close range. They’re relaxed and photogenic, which makes wildlife spotting easy even if you don’t have binoculars.
- Lowland fynbos and renosterveld — This small park protects rare coastal fynbos and renosterveld habitats that you won’t find everywhere. The plant mix is unique to the region and supports lots of local biodiversity.
- Breede River and riverine forest — The river cuts a scenic ribbon through the park: shady riverbanks, reflective pools and a different microhabitat full of life. Great for a slow riverside walk or a picnic with views.
- Birdwatching — The river, wetlands and open grassland attract a tidy variety of birds (kingfishers, herons and raptors among them). Fine for casual birders and serious twitchers alike, especially around dawn and dusk.
- Easy walking and cycling trails — The park has a handful of well-marked trails and quiet gravel roads that are perfect for short hikes, longer loop walks or mountain biking. It’s relaxed terrain, so you can cover ground without a guide and still feel immersed in nature.
- Seasonal wildflower displays — In spring the fynbos and renosterveld burst into colour with bulbs and daisies. If you time it right you’ll see carpets of blooms that make the low hills look entirely different from the rest of the year.
- Sunsets, campsites and quiet solitude — The park’s small size and open horizons create memorable sunsets. Staying overnight at a campsite or one of the cottages gives you early-morning and late-afternoon wildlife windows when things are most active.
